KLE Society's Science & Commerce College in Mumbai, Maharashtra, India offers a range of scholarship opportunities to support students from diverse backgrounds. These include merit-based, need-based, and government scholarships, with options covering categories like SC, ST, OBC, EWS, and outstanding academic or co-curricular performance. The college prioritizes making quality education accessible through fee waivers and financial aid, ensuring that deserving students can pursue higher education with reduced financial pressure.

KLE Society's Science & Commerce College Eligibility
Eligibility for scholarships generally considers factors such as academic merit (minimum marks in 10th/12th, often above 60–75%), government-reserved categories (SC/ST/OBC/NT/SBC), and annual family income (with EWS cut-offs as per state or central notifications, typically up to INR 8 lakh). Some awards also recognize students excelling in sports at state or national level or meeting specific criteria for single girl children or defense personnel wards.
KLE Society's Science & Commerce College Required Documents
Applicants must submit verified documents to establish their eligibility for any scholarship. The most commonly required documents include:
10th/12th marksheet
Caste certificate (for reserved category)
Income certificate (issued by competent authority)
Recent passport-size photograph
Domicile or residence proof
KLE Society's Science & Commerce College Application Process
The scholarship application process is typically initiated at the time of admission or during defined application windows announced by the college. Students can apply through the college office or relevant government portals (e.g., National Scholarship Portal for central/state schemes). Timely submission of accurate documentation by the stated deadlines is essential, as incomplete or late applications may not be considered.
KLE Society's Science & Commerce College Scholarship Details
The table below summarises the primary scholarships available at the KLE Society's Science & Commerce College, Mumbai campus. Actual awards depend on relevant verification and the number of available slots as notified in each academic year.
Scholarship Name | Eligibility Criteria | Benefit | Notes (if any) |
Government of India Post-Matric Scholarship (SC/ST/NT/SBC) | Belonging to respective reserved category; family income as per GOI norms; enrolled in eligible course | Full or partial tuition fee waiver, hostel/living expenses support | Apply annually on National Scholarship Portal |
Central/State OBC & EWS Scholarship | OBC/EWS category as per Maharashtra/GOI; family income within notified limit (typically up to INR 8 lakh); valid certificates | Partial fee support or reimbursement | State-specific process; upload certificates during admission |
State Open Merit Scholarship | High academic merit (generally minimum 75% in qualifying examination) | Monthly stipend or fee waiver | Competition-based, subject to state quota |
Institutional/College Merit Award | Highest marks in college/university entrance or qualifying exam; limited to top rankers | Fee waiver (partial, up to 100%) | Merit list published by college annually |
KLE Society's Science & Commerce College Additional Notes
Scholarship renewal often requires maintaining a prescribed minimum CGPA (usually above 6.0/10), good attendance, and adherence to college conduct rules. Typically, students may only avail one major scholarship per academic year. Budgets or seats for each scholarship type are capped annually as per government or institutional policy. All awards are contingent on verification of submitted documents and compliance with deadlines.
